Output c7ca072bc00584f436c30d7068cf90bfc59d329d1a13c54ffb6f00682d4a20e1:0

value
428011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a62cb62c553f82d1658a461ff75e242a6001b5 OP_EQUAL
address
39E2QHr6uFCT3zyWxZAYtNG2fxmfVCBb4s
transaction
c7ca072bc00584f436c30d7068cf90bfc59d329d1a13c54ffb6f00682d4a20e1
confirmations
196575
spent
true